Minty Onion Rings for Burgers and Wraps

Although easy, this recipe does taste quite different, because unlike the regular green chutney, this one uses more of mint leaves than coriander.
You can use Minty Onion Rings in wraps like Paneer Tikka Kathi Roll and Pindi Chole Roll to make them more flavourful.

Ingredients
Main Ingredients
1 cup onion rings
For The Green Chutney
1 cup roughly chopped mint leaves (phudina)
1/2 cup roughly chopped coriander (dhania)
1 tsp cumin seeds (jeera)
1 tbsp roughly chopped green chillies
1 tsp lemon juice
salt to taste
Method
- Combine all the ingredients in a mixer and blend to a smooth paste using 2 tbsp of water.
- Combine the onion rings and green chutney in a deep bowl and mix well.
- Serve immediately.
